The gold refining technique described here is the rather ancient wet chemical method whereby the goldbearing scrap is dissolved in aquaregia. m is gold solution is then filtered and the jewelers bench dirt, sandpaper grit, grinding wheel grains and similar material remains on the filter as a solid sludge, together with any silver present ...
Sulfuric acid: Sulfuric acid, dense, colorless, oily, corrosive liquid; one of the most important of all chemicals, prepared industrially by the reaction of water with sulfur trioxide. In one of its most familiar applications, sulfuric acid serves as the electrolyte in leadacid storage batteries.

Oct 24, 2014· Amino Acids Key to Gold Extraction Method. Using the amino acid glycine to extract gold, he says, has many advantages over the traditional cyanide and sulfuric acid treatments. "It's a bulk chemical, it's affordable and it's benign," Eksteen says. "It forms a stable soluble complex with gold, which is soluble in water.".

The sulfate ion carries a negative two charge and is the conjugate base of the hydrogen sulfate ion, HSO4, which is the conjugate base of H2SO4, sulfuric acid. In inorganic chemistry, a sulfate (IUPACrecommended spelling; also sulphate in British English) is a salt of sulfuric acid.
Feb 10, 2014· You can use sodium bisulfate, the acid salt of sulfuric acid. (This is not to be confused with sodium bisulfITE, a different material altogether.) It is a white powder and dissolves in water to give very strongly acidic solutions.

The Acid Plant Sulfur dioxide gas from the flash furnace is captured and combined with water in an adjacent acid plant to produce sulfuric acid is sold as a byproduct to chemical manufacturers in the United States. The Hayden smelter produces 2,500 tons of highpurity sulfuric acid every day.
Apr 15, 2017· Actually, most of the elemental sulfur used for the production of sulfuric acid is a byproduct of natural gas and petroleum refining. These byproducts contain mainly % sulfur. The main impurity is carbon from natural gas or petroleum. Sulfur melting point is 115120 0 C, depending on the crystal structure. It is melted with pressurized ...
